Emergency Lighting Compliance & Legal Requirements
Ensuring your building meets emergency lighting compliance is not just a safety measure - it’s a legal requirement. In Essex, all commercial, public, and industrial premises must have emergency lighting in place to guide occupants safely during power failures or emergencies. Properly installed and maintained systems reduce the risk of accidents, protect your staff and visitors, and ensure your business stays on the right side of UK fire safety law.
Compliance involves more than just having lights - it requires regular testing, maintenance, and record-keeping to meet British Standards (BS 5266) and the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005. Businesses that fail to comply risk fines, legal action, and invalidated insurance policies, making professional support essential.
- Emergency lighting installed in all escape routes and high-risk areas
- Monthly function tests and annual full-discharge tests
- Inspections by a qualified emergency lighting engineer
- Accurate, up-to-date maintenance and test records
- Systems designed to meet BS 5266 standards and UK fire safety law

Emergency lighting is a backup lighting system that activates during power failures, guiding occupants safely to exits in commercial and public buildings. In Essex, it’s a legal requirement under BS 5266 and the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005, helping protect staff, visitors, and customers while ensuring your business stays compliant.
-
By law, emergency lighting systems must undergo monthly functional tests and annual full-discharge tests. These inspections ensure all lights operate correctly during an emergency. Keeping detailed test records is essential for compliance inspections by Essex Fire & Rescue Service.
-
Most non-domestic buildings require emergency lighting. This includes offices, retail units, warehouses, schools, care homes, and leisure facilities. Key areas that must be covered include escape routes, stairwells, corridors, and high-risk zones, ensuring safe evacuation during an emergency.
-
Failing to maintain compliant emergency lighting can result in fines, enforcement notices, and legal action from Essex Fire & Rescue Service. It may also invalidate insurance policies and put staff, visitors, and customers at risk. Regular maintenance and professional installation mitigate these risks.
